What is Standard Deviation?
Standard deviation is a statistical measurement that shows how much variation exists in a set of numbers.
- A low standard deviation means your data points are close to the average.
- A high standard deviation means your data points are spread out over a wider range.
It is widely used in:
- Education and academic research
- Finance and investment analysis
- Business performance tracking
- Quality control and manufacturing
- Data science and analytics

Example Calculation
Let’s walk through a real example to better understand how the calculator works.
Input Data:
5, 10, 15, 20, 25
Results:
- Mean: 15
- Standard Deviation: 7.07
Explanation:
- The average of the numbers is 15.
- The standard deviation shows how far each number is from the average.
- Since the value is moderate, the data is somewhat spread out but still centered around the mean.

9. What is the difference between variance and standard deviation?
Variance is the square of standard deviation, while standard deviation is easier to interpret.
10. Does this tool calculate sample or population standard deviation?
It calculates population standard deviation by default.
